Output fb21b265d8698655371d376720c2eee0e2e27590054d1371b0b707c09534a2cc:0

value
332617461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c27386606e9d7aa7e019e39fffdcf5acae9a8fff OP_EQUAL
address
3KRBQa2ZovUoEejrgA81X5m4zy1BZHJmXC
transaction
fb21b265d8698655371d376720c2eee0e2e27590054d1371b0b707c09534a2cc
spent
true